// +build race
package git
import (
"testing"
"time"
)
func TestRunInDirTimeoutPipelineNoTimeout(t *testing.T) {
maxLoops := 1000
// 'git --version' does not block so it must be finished before the timeout triggered.
cmd := NewCommand("--version")
for i := 0; i < maxLoops; i++ {
if err := cmd.RunInDirTimeoutPipeline(-1, "", nil, nil); err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
}
}
func TestRunInDirTimeoutPipelineAlwaysTimeout(t *testing.T) {
maxLoops := 1000
// 'git hash-object --stdin' blocks on stdin so we can have the timeout triggered.
cmd := NewCommand("hash-object --stdin")
for i := 0; i < maxLoops; i++ {
if err := cmd.RunInDirTimeoutPipeline(1*time.Microsecond, "", nil, nil); err != nil {
// 'context deadline exceeded' when the error is returned by exec.Start
// 'signal: killed' when the error is returned by exec.Wait
// It depends on the point of the time (before or after exec.Start returns) at which the timeout is triggered.
if err.Error() != "context deadline exceeded" && err.Error() != "signal: killed" {
t.Fatalf("Testing %d/%d: %v", i, maxLoops, err)
}
}
}
}
